usb: hub: avoid warm port reset during USB3 disconnect
During disconnect USB-3 ports often go via SS.Inactive link error state before the missing terminations are noticed, and link finally goes to RxDetect state Avoid immediately warm-resetting ports in SS.Inactive state. Let ports settle for a while and re-read the link status a few times 20ms apart to see if the ports transitions out of SS.Inactive. According to USB 3.x spec 7.5.2, a port in SS.Inactive should automatically check for missing far-end receiver termination every 12 ms (SSInactiveQuietTimeout) The futile multiple warm reset retries of a disconnected device takes a lot of time, also the resetting of a removed devices has caused cases where the reset bit got stuck for a long time on xHCI roothub. This lead to issues in detecting new devices connected to the same port shortly after.
